A responsible parent is someone who takes care of their children by providing them with their basic needs, such as food, shelter, and education. They also make sure their children are safe, healthy, and happy. Responsible parents do not spoil their children just because they love them, but they provide guidance, set rules and boundaries, and teach their children important values and life skills. They work hard to earn a living to support their family, and they may seek help from others, but they do not rely solely on hired help to raise their children.
